Ohio Payroll Employment By County for The Private Trade Transportation And Utilities Industry in July, 2019
Updated on October 9, 2022.

According to recent data from the US Bureau of Labor Statistics, in July, 2019, Ohio added 2,296 number of jobs to the private trade, transportation, and utilities industry. Among Ohio counties, Licking added the highest number of jobs (1,149), followed by Franklin (964), and Cuyahoga (872).

County Number of Employment Jobs Added
Adams 1184 13
Allen 9373 103
Ashland 3354 -34
Ashtabula 4942 13
Athens 3045 -29
Auglaize 3408 -19
Belmont 5509 5
Brown 1448 -24
Butler 38943 35
Carroll 1364 24
Champaign 1540 -3
Clark 9208 28
Clermont 14429 -136
Clinton 6146 35
Columbiana 5527 125
Coshocton 1753 -36
Crawford 2033 -18
Cuyahoga 119737 872
Darke 3938 -6
Defiance 3288 -80
Delaware 17075 26
Erie 6471 -43
Fairfield 8559 50
Fayette 4134 36
Franklin 144845 964
Fulton 3008 -27
Gallia 2378 -28
Geauga 7430 -3
Greene 12393 -50
Guernsey 2619 -34
Hamilton 77453 -567
Hancock 10274 -190
Hardin 1277 -11
Harrison 875 -32
Henry 1867 2
Highland 2092 -1
Hocking 963 -26
Holmes 4329 -7
Huron 3748 -47
Jackson 1861 5
Jefferson 5167 -82
Knox 2909 7
Lake 18150 124
Lawrence 2764 21
Licking 17090 1149
Logan 4500 21
Lorain 18476 -267
Lucas 35862 189
Madison 5644 278
Mahoning 19930 198
Marion 4329 -44
Medina 14647 61
Meigs 727 8
Mercer 4082 -33
Miami 8711 -116
Monroe 675 21
Montgomery 42058 23
Morgan 637 -20
Morrow 802 0
Muskingum 7639 16
Noble 544 0
Ottawa 3065 21
Paulding 865 4
Perry 1076 -12
Pickaway 2332 8
Pike 1864 3
Portage 11201 -24
Preble 1861 -9
Putnam 1884 1
Richland 9469 -67
Ross 5387 -59
Sandusky 3855 -14
Scioto 3949 -16
Seneca 3522 -2
Shelby 4242 22
Stark 28525 6
Summit 53634 156
Trumbull 14529 59
Tuscarawas 6656 -46
Union 5203 50
Van Wert 2503 19
Vinton 364 -17
Warren 18620 155
Washington 4918 -74
Wayne 8199 171
Williams 3535 70
Wood 15174 143
Wyandot 1243 -4
